IrBiO2F is an iridium-bismuth oxide fluoride ceramic compound, representing a mixed-metal oxide fluoride system that combines transition metal (Ir) and post-transition metal (Bi) chemistry. This is an experimental or specialized research material rather than a widely commercialized engineering ceramic. The material family is of interest for applications requiring high chemical stability, potential catalytic activity, or specialized electronic/ionic properties that emerge from the iridium-bismuth-oxygen-fluorine combination.
